Section 1: User Pain Points and Product Solutions

What Users Are Complaining About

Remote workers and technical professionals report a systemic failure in their digital and physical ecosystems. Intrusive UI updates and fragile hardware frequently disrupt deep-work states. Users are exhausted by "workflow shuffling"—constantly reorganizing cluttered desks or fixing unreliable equipment. Current mass-market gear lacks the durability and ergonomic precision required for high-stakes professional output, leading to significant mental fatigue and lost productivity.

  • Engagement data: 3 unique clusters, 14.9 resonance score
  • Common complaint: "I spend more time fixing my desk setup than actually working."
  • Why current products fail: Focus on superficial aesthetics rather than ruggedized, predictable, and modular design.

Cost Structure (USA Market)

Factory price:       $45
Ocean freight:       $8 per unit
Import duties:       $5
Landed cost:         $58
Retail price:        $160
Profit margin:       64%
